So I wanted to create a video showing how a F250 6.7 Diesel performs while towing a 11,500 lb travel trailer in the summer heat.
The day I had this planned it was 100 degrees outside with heat index reading around 107. Brutal yet perfect for this test. I have a highway run I have made other videos on showing MPG...normal driving, extreme MPG, etc.
This video shows while towing a 11,500 travel trailer how the engine performs shifting, tackling a 4% grade at 65 MPG (I know it's no Ike Gauntlet Ha ha) then some engine brake/jake brake performance.
This video may help anyone looking to see how a vehicle like this would perform with towing a heavy travel trailer.
P.S. My TT is a 2017 Mesa Ridge 328 BHS. Same as an Open Range 328 BHS. For those who are curious about this trailer...it's a big boy. 4 slide outs, bunkhouse, outdoor kitchen, 6'10" ceilings throughout (I'm 6'7" so I needed that kind of a ceiling). 1.5 baths. It has a 10,000 lb dry weight and with how I have it equipped I would say it weight about 11,500 lbs. I upgrade the tires to Goodyear Endurance, I love them. I use a WDH. (Truck is 100% stock.)
